Long Live Great Bardfield!
Saturday 31st March 2012
"Long Live Great Bardfield" will bring together a fascinating collection of paintings, prints, drawings and photographs in support of the autobiography of Tirzah Garwood, (Mrs Eric Ravilious), published in 2012
Closes 24th June 2012

Edward Bawden: Seven Decades of Watercolour
Saturday 30th June 2012
to 2nd September
Bawden's considerable reputation in printmaking has sometimes meant that his achievements as an artist in watercolour are overlooked, although he worked in this medium all his life. This exhibition draws on the gallery's own extensive collection of his watercolours, with augmentation, and demonstrates his work starting while he was at school, through his studies at the Royal Collage of Art, and many exhibitions and commissions until his death in 1989, and will be a rare opportunity to follow Bawden's career exclusively in this field.
